Factors to Consider When Choosing Cordless Electric Paint Sprayers

Choosing the right cordless electric paint sprayer involves balancing several key factors. While price is important, understanding how features impact your specific needs ensures better long-term results. A well-chosen sprayer can make a difference in project quality, time, and effort. Here are some critical considerations to keep in mind when making your selection.

Battery Life and Power

Battery performance determines how long you can work without recharging, directly impacting project efficiency. Higher voltage batteries, such as 20V or 18V, typically provide more consistent spray and can handle larger tanks or thicker paints. However, more powerful batteries often add weight, which may cause fatigue during extended use. Consider your project size and whether you prefer shorter, more frequent bursts or longer continuous spraying sessions. Investing in models with dual batteries or fast-charging options can minimize downtime, especially for larger projects.

Tank Capacity and Spray Volume

Tank size influences how much paint you can apply before needing a refill. Larger tanks (above 1200 ml) are ideal for big projects like walls or furniture, reducing interruptions. Smaller tanks are lighter and easier to maneuver but require more frequent refills, which can slow down work. Think about your typical project scope—if you often work on large surfaces, prioritize capacity; for detail work or smaller areas, a compact tank might be more manageable. Remember that larger tanks can add weight, so balance capacity with ease of handling.

Nozzle and Pattern Versatility

Multiple nozzles and adjustable spray patterns increase flexibility, allowing you to switch between fine finishing and broad coverage. HVLP (High Volume Low Pressure) nozzles often provide smoother finishes and less overspray, ideal for furniture or detailed work. Variable pattern controls help adapt to different surfaces, whether flat walls or textured ceilings. However, more nozzles and settings can complicate operation and cleaning. Consider your typical projects and choose a sprayer that offers the right combination of pattern options without overwhelming you with complexity.

Ease of Use and Maintenance

Lightweight designs and ergonomic grips reduce fatigue, especially on larger jobs. Clear instructions for assembly and cleaning can save time and frustration, as paint sprayers require regular maintenance to perform well. Models with quick-clean features or fewer parts are advantageous for frequent use. Remember that some sprayers might require disassembly for cleaning, which can be time-consuming and messy. Prioritize user-friendly features if you plan to use the sprayer regularly or on multiple projects.

Price and Long-Term Value

While budget options are tempting, they often sacrifice durability, spray quality, or battery life. Higher-priced models tend to offer better performance, longer-lasting batteries, and more precise adjustments, which can justify the investment over time. Consider your project frequency and whether buying a premium model aligns with your needs. Sometimes, spending more initially results in fewer frustrations and better results, especially for frequent or professional use. Look for warranties and customer support as additional indicators of value.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does the battery last on average for cordless paint sprayers?

Battery life varies depending on the model and usage, but most cordless paint sprayers offer between 20 to 40 minutes of continuous operation on a single charge. Higher-capacity batteries or dual-battery systems can extend this period, making longer projects more manageable. If you plan to work on large surfaces, consider models with quick-charging features or extra batteries to avoid interruptions. Keep in mind that thinner paints or lower spray pressures tend to conserve battery life as well.

Can I use thicker paints with cordless electric paint sprayers?

Many cordless sprayers are designed for water-based paints and thin coatings, but some models with higher viscosity ratings can handle thicker paints. Always check the manufacturer’s specifications for viscosity limits; exceeding these can clog the nozzle or impair spray quality. Using a thinning agent or selecting a model with a powerful motor can improve performance with thicker materials. For frequent use with heavy paints, a professional-grade sprayer with higher viscosity capabilities is often worth considering.

Are cordless paint sprayers suitable for large projects?

Yes, but with some caveats. Larger tanks and longer battery life make cordless sprayers more feasible for extensive jobs, such as entire rooms or furniture sets. However, the added weight of bigger tanks and batteries can cause fatigue during prolonged use. For very large projects, consider models with dual batteries or rapid-charging capabilities to maintain productivity. Also, plan for breaks to clean nozzles and manage heat buildup, ensuring consistent spray quality throughout the task.

How easy is it to clean a cordless paint sprayer after use?

Cleaning ease varies widely among models. Some sprayers feature quick-release nozzles, removable tanks, and integrated cleaning modes, simplifying maintenance. Others require disassembly, which can be time-consuming and messy. Using water-based paints generally makes cleaning easier, but oil-based paints demand more thorough cleanup with solvents.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ions and consider models with features designed for straightforward cleaning, especially if you plan to switch colors or finishes frequently.

Is it worth investing in a more expensive cordless paint sprayer?

Higher-end models often deliver better spray consistency, longer battery life, and enhanced durability, which can justify the higher price over the long term. If you frequently perform painting projects or require professional-quality results, investing in a premium sprayer can save time, reduce frustration, and produce superior finishes. However, for occasional DIY tasks, a mid-range or budget option may suffice, provided it meets your project needs. Carefully evaluate your usage volume and desired results to decide whether the investment aligns with your expectations.
